On Friday, Šilalė Deputy Mayor Tadas Bartkus shared on social media the news that UAB Ambulansas executives and their relatives who came from Vilnius could be vaccinated against the coronavirus in Šilalė. Shortly thereafter, the Ministry of Health announced that investigations would be launched.

On Friday, the deputy mayor of Šilalė announced on social media that, together with the doctors from Šilal junto, more people had been vaccinated against the coronavirus, such as the executives of the UAB Ambulansas and their relatives, who had even arrived from Vilnius. The deputy mayor claims to have received a complaint for fraudulent vaccines.

On Saturday, R. Ūselis Delfi, who had no medical education, could not be reached. He told the “15 min” portal that “he did not feel he had done anything wrong and stated that the vaccinated relatives would come to the aid station to volunteer if necessary.”

“And we are not doctors?” Ambulance “, not doctors? We asked, they assigned us and we went, we got vaccinated. Employees, volunteers, because half of our brigades are sick from the crown,” the businessman explained to the portal.

President Gitanas Nausėda called the unsuccessful attempts to obtain vaccines “shameful relics of Soviet behavior” and demanded swift and decisive decisions on the responsibility of those who violated the vaccination regime.

The head of state said he had demanded a clear and detailed vaccination procedure and suggestions on how to remedy the situation from Health Minister Arūnas Dulkis, with whom he intends to meet on Monday morning.

At the time, Prime Minister Ingrida Šimonytė asserts that the responsibility for implementing adequate vaccination rests with the heads of medical institutions.

The Special Investigation Service (STT) announced Saturday night that it had decided to conduct an anti-corruption assessment of the COVID-19 vaccine organization. Three MPs from the ruling Conservative Party reported that they had submitted a request to the Attorney General’s Office to launch a pre-trial investigation into the abuses at the Šilalė GMP station, the Žalgiris clinic, and the Panevėžys and Šilutė hospitals.

The fact that vaccines are sometimes given to physicians in direct contact with coronavirus patients and in priority groups has been reported since late December, when Lithuania received the first batch of vaccine and began vaccination.
